About Ehud Shafir
Ehud Shafir is a scholar working on Instrumentation,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 53 papers that have together received 785 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Fiber Optic Sensors (34 papers), Photonic and Optical Devices (22 papers) and Advanced Fiber Laser Technologies (17 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Instrumentation (97 citations), Bioengineering (62 citations) and Electrical and Electronic Engineering (528 citations). Ehud Shafir has collaborated with scholars based in Israel, United States and Norway. Frequent co-authors include Garry Berkovic, Moshe Tur, K. Blötekjær, David Avnir, Yehiam Prior, I. Gilath, Min Shen, Semion K. Saikin, Paulo Antunes and María José Pontes.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Applied Physics, Chemistry of Materials and Physical Review B.
